Only a few people, including Protopop Avvakum, refused to submit to the church Cathedral of 1666-1667, which finally and irrevocably approved the reform of the Russian Church. They were deprived of the dignity and were anathematized. But after them, more and more Russian people began to show fidelity to the ancient Russian church tradition. Thus, the powerful movement of the Old Believers developed, which came off the church and formed independent communities that did not want to submit to the will of the bishop and the states behind it and ready to uphold the right to their rites and liturgical books. Why and how this happened, which served as the background of the tragic Russian split and what role Tsar Alexei Mikhailovich, Patriarch Nikon and Greek patriarchs played in it, is told in the study of one of the largest historians of the Russian abroad Sergei Zenkovsky.

Sergey Zenkovsky (1907-1990) - historian, Slavist, researcher of the Russian schism, professor of history of Stetson University
